Preparing for Your Appointment

To ensure a smooth first visit, consider the following preparations:​

  • Documentation: Bring a valid photo ID, dental insurance information, and a list of current medications.
  • Arrival Time: Aim to arrive 15 minutes early to complete any necessary paperwork without feeling rushed.
  • Medical History: Be prepared to discuss your medical and dental history, including any previous treatments or ongoing concerns.​

What Happens During Your First Visit

1. Warm Welcome and Check-In

Upon arrival at MOVA Dental, our friendly front desk staff will greet you and assist with the check-in process. They will verify your information and ensure all necessary forms are completed.​

2. Comprehensive Oral Examination

Dr. Ramin Movafaghi will conduct a thorough examination of your teeth, gums, and oral tissues. This includes checking for signs of decay, gum disease, and other potential issues. Digital X-rays may be taken to provide a detailed view of your oral health.

3. Personalized Treatment Plan

Based on the examination findings, Dr. Movafaghi will discuss any concerns and recommend a tailored treatment plan. This plan will address your specific needs and outline the next steps for maintaining or improving your oral health.

4. Scheduling Follow-Up Appointments

Before concluding your visit, our staff will assist you in scheduling any necessary follow-up appointments. They will also provide information on preventive care and answer any questions you may have.​

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How long does the first dental visit take?

Typically, the initial appointment lasts about 60 to 90 minutes. This allows ample time for a comprehensive examination, discussion of findings, and addressing any questions.​

2. Will I receive a cleaning during my first visit?

Depending on your oral health status and the dentist’s assessment, a cleaning may be performed during the first visit or scheduled for a subsequent appointment.​
